Posted By: Shiollie Re: question about datura's..... - July 7th, 2005 at 07:14 PM
Hi Linda, The bloom from the Datura will only last a day or 2 and they will droop in the heat of the day. I move mine into the shade in the hottest part of the day and the blooms will perk up. If you dont want more seeds remove the seed capsule because they will put an awful lot of energy into those capsules at the expense of blooms. Datura are very heavy feeders so you might want to feed it a diluted fertilizer at every watering.
A side note... When you get your next bloom, smell it in the morning then smell it again when the sun goes down, it seems that the perfume really increases at night. I have a double yellow and the scent at night is intoxicating!
